NewsNation, America's newest primetime cable news network, is seeking to hire an experienced Digital Reporter responsible for creating digital-first content for the cable network's digital platforms.

NewsNation is America's source for unbiased news, where engaged citizens get news that represents the full range of perspectives across the country. The team is led by veteran journalists and draws on the local, regional and national expertise of Nexstar's 5,400 journalists in 110 local newsrooms across the country. Formerly known as WGN America, the network is owned and operated by Nexstar Media Inc, the country's largest owner of local TV stations, and reaches 75 million television households in the US

RESPONSIBILITIES
• Pitch multiple story ideas a day.
• Interview and research assigned story topics.
• Write multiple originally reported web stories per shift.
• Develop multiple ideas off a single news topic to push stories forward daily.
• Build relationships with subject matter experts and organizations that support your beat(s).
• Utilize SEO best practices in your writing.
• Use digital analytics and social media platforms to understand content that resonates with audience to inform future content pitches.

REQUIREMENTS
• Bachelor's degree in journalism, advertising or marketing or an equivalent combination of education and work-related experience
• 3+ years working as a digital reporter or producer in a major market or national newsroom
• Strong news judgement and ability to determine when local stories have national appeal
• Print reporting background a plus
• Excellent communicator, both oral written
• Flexibility to work weekend shifts
